High-temperature-resistant super alloy (HRSA) materials are notorious for their difficulty in machining, posing significant challenges in production processes. Traditional ceramic inserts have shown potential but struggle with the adverse effects of high heat on the cutting edge. Bidemics, an innovative ceramic material blended with other elements, offers a breakthrough in addressing these challenges by significantly enhancing thermal conductivity properties.
